……thought they were, study says

"Neanderthals may not have sported the barrel-chested bodies and hunched posture we see in museums and textbooks, according to a new study.

The first 3D virtual reconstruction of a Neanderthal ribcage has revealed that they had straighter spines and a greater lung capacity than modern humans. The findings about the Neanderthal, also spelled Neandertal, were published Tuesday in the journal Nature Communications.

"Neandertals are closely related to us with complex cultural adaptations much like those of modern humans, but their physical form is different from us in important ways," said Patricia Kramer, corresponding study author and professor in the University of Washington department of anthropology. "Understanding their adaptations allows us to understand our own evolutionary path better."…."
